Chania Pelion

4
(1)
Chania is a small mountain village located at one of the highest points of Mount Pelion. It is known for its cool climate, panoramic viewpoints, and as a key stop on the road connecting Volos with the eastern Pelion coast.

How to Get There

  • 🚗 By Car: About 40 minutes 🛣️ from Volos 🏁
  • 🛣️ Main road connecting Volos 🏙️ and eastern Pelion 🌊
  • 🚌 Public transport: Limited bus 🚍 services available 🛑

Travel Tips

  • ☁️ Weather can change ⛈️ very quickly 🌬️
  • 🧥 Cooler temperatures even 🌡️ in the summer ❄️
  • 📸 Good stop for 🧘 rest and photos 📷
